What is a Psychiatrist?
A psychiatrist is a medical doctor who concentrates on the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of mental health disorders. Unlike other mental health specialists, such as psychologists or therapists, psychiatrists are licensed to recommend medication. They can likewise supply therapy and other types of treatment, making them uniquely certified to deal with a wide variety of mental health concerns.

Q: How do I understand if I need to see a psychiatrist?A: If you are experiencing relentless symptoms of stress and anxiety, depression, or other mental health problems that disrupt your every day life, it may be time to see a psychiatrist. A medical care service provider can also help identify if a referral is essential.
Q: Can a psychiatrist recommend medication without a medical diagnosis?A: No, a psychiatrist should diagnose a mental health condition before recommending medication. This ensures that the medication is appropriate and efficient for your particular requirements.
Q: How often will I require to see a psychiatrist?A: The frequency of consultations depends upon your condition and treatment strategy. At first, you may have more frequent check outs, however as your condition stabilizes, visits might end up being less frequent.
Q: Is psychiatry covered by insurance?A: Many insurance plans cover psychiatric services, however protection differs. It's crucial to consult your insurance provider to understand what is covered and any associated costs.
Q: What if I don't feel comfy with my psychiatrist?A: It's necessary to find a psychiatrist with whom you feel comfy. If you do not click with your present psychiatrist, it's completely appropriate to seek a second opinion or find a new one.
Q: Can I see a psychiatrist without a referral?A: Some psychiatrists accept patients straight, however it depends on their practice policies. If a referral is required, you can acquire one from your medical care service provider.
